White jeans can be tricky to wear can't they?
I love the look of them, but they aren't very practical for 'real life'.
White jeans are undoubtedly a dirt magnet, and certainly can't be worn more than once before heading into the wash.
White jeans can also be unforgiving, showing your underwear (VPL...yuck!) or highlighting any lumps and bumps.
BUT...
White jeans look so fresh, clean and modern!
Wearing white jeans is a great way to look spring-like without losing the extra warmth that denim provides.
They also give off the impression that you are an organised and "pulled together" person.
{Subconsciously people assume that you must be organised...see THIS POST about the messages colour can send.}
White jeans are the perfect transitional piece.

These white jeans are straight legged and give off a slouchy, laid-back vibe on my narrow frame.
I cuffed the ankle to add to the casual feel... and show off my shoes!
Straight leg jeans are probably the most versatile of all jean styles.
They work for most body shapes and can easily be made to look smart (or as smart as jeans can look!) or very casual, depending on your mood.
This pair are a true (blueish) white that looks bright and crisp against other colours.
I decided to keep the colour palette cool and subtle, although this shirt is a warm shade of blue and the peep at the collar is just enough to make these colours "fit" my warm colouring.
Bright white is not a colour I suit.
It makes me look washed out and dark under the eyes, but I still wear it anyway!
Wearing a 'tricky' colour on your bottom half (away from you face) is a great way to make it work for you.
